NettetSuppose we are looking for the limit of the composite function f (g (x)) at x=a. This limit would be equal to the value of f (L), where L is the limit of g (x) at x=a, under two conditions. First, that the limit of g (x) at x=a exists (and if so, let's say it equals L). Second, that f is continuous at x=L. If one of these conditions isn't met ...

We will often write. lim x → a f ( x) = L. which should be read as. The limit of f ( x) as x approaches a is L. The notation is just shorthand — we don't want to have to write out long sentences as we do our mathematics. Whenever you see these symbols you should think of that sentence. portale hepatitis
